Explore the hidden history behind McDonald’s rise from a small drive-in to a global fast food empire shaped by aggressive expansion and psychological design. Discover how branding, franchising systems, and marketing strategies transformed McDonald’s into a powerful real estate and consumer machine.

Ep 1:

The Trap Built on Two Brothers' Dream

McDonald's isn't a burger company — it's a psychological trap, and its origin story starts with two hardworking brothers and the ruthless salesman who stole their dream.

Ep 2:

Stolen Land, Stolen Magic

Ray Kroc turns hamburgers into a real estate empire and betrays the McDonald brothers, while McDonald's steals an entire children's TV universe to capture young hearts.

Ep 3:

Mobsters, Monopoly, and Millions

McDonald's beloved Monopoly game promised millions to lucky customers — but for over a decade, the mob was secretly rigging every big win.

Ep 4:

What's Really in That Box?

From immortal burgers to aluminum-laced nuggets and a rigged ice cream machine, we dig into the disturbing chemistry hiding inside your favorite meal.

Ep 5:

Your Gut on Golden Arches

We tally the true cost of the Golden Arches on your body — vanishing gut bacteria, liver damage, and a sugar bomb disguised as a milkshake.
